How is Pro-Cote made?

0

Soy polymers are manufactured from soybeans — an abundant, renewable and recyclable resource. During the initial soybean processing, the oil and hull are removed. The remaining flakes, our basic raw material, undergo an extraction process. The extract contains isolated soy protein in its native or globular form and soluble, low molecular weight sugars. The isolated protein molecule is highly reactive and can be chemically treated in various reactive processes to modify the protein chain to impart desired functional properties. These chemical processes are used to modify the functional nature of the soy polymer and optimize the properties for use in industrial applications. Soy Polymers’ patented processing technology generates a variety of Pro-Cote grades varying in functional characteristics.
